Petrangelo Runs Out of Time Banks

Level 7 : 10,000/15,000, 15,000 ante

Nick Petrangelo opened to 35,000 from under the gun and Mikita Badziakouski re-raised to 90,000 on his left. The action folded back to Petrangelo who called.

The flop came {q-Spades}{q-Hearts}{10-Hearts} and Petrangelo check-called a bet of 40,000 from Badziakouski. The {2-Diamonds} hit the turn and both players checked to the {7-Spades} on the river.

Petrangelo checked again and Badziakouski flicked in a bet of 200,000. Petrangelo went into the tank and used his last three time banks before finally sliding his cards to the muck. Petrangelo will need to negotiate the last 3.5 levels with only 30 seconds to complete each action.
